j, k, l, and m Modes (Setting the Exposure for Shooting) In j, k, l, and m modes, you can set exposure (combination of shutter speed and f-number) according to the shooting conditions. Also, you can achieve greater control when shooting images by setting the shooting menu options (A114). Shooting mode Description You can let the camera adjust the shutter speed and f-number. • The combination of shutter speed and f-number can be changed by rotating the command dial (flexible program). j Programmed auto While the flexible program is in effect, the A (flexible program mark) is displayed on the upper left of the screen. • To cancel the flexible program, rotate the command dial in the opposite direction than when you set it until the A is no longer displayed, change the shooting mode, or turn off the camera. k Shutter-priority auto Rotate the command dial to set the shutter speed. The camera automatically determines the f-number. l Aperture-priority auto Rotate the multi selector to set the f-number. The camera automatically determines the shutter speed. m Manual Set both the shutter speed and f-number. Rotate the command dial to set the shutter speed. Rotate the multi selector to set the f-number. • The allocations of the controls for setting the exposure can be changed using Toggle Av/Tv selection in the setup menu (A111).
